With the release of 'Greetings From Texas' and 'Greetings From Tennessee', '?and more bears records' inaugurated its project on regional music. Now we have added 'Greetings from Oklahoma, 'Greetings From Hawaii,' 'Greetings From Georgia,' and 'Greetings from Alabama.'
Each CD in the series features a generous collection of songs focused upon a particular state. In true '?and more bears' fashion, we will include both well-known titles (such as Oklahoma Hills and Everybody Does It In Hawaii) as well as more obscure items drawn from the 'deep catalogue' of numerous record companies. No matter how much of a patriot or a record collector you are, this series will manage to surprise you. Each entry will also feature a blend of famous artists like Hank Williams and Willie Nelson rubbing shoulders with singers who were barely household names in their own homes. Their common goal is to sing the pride of life in a particular state.

Each CD will be accompanied by a humorous but informative essay by music historian Hank Davis. The songs we select will represent the decades from the 1940s through the 1990s, although the lion's share of the selections will be more vintage or 'classic' country music.
